Illinois HB 2617 (101st) — PEN CD-CTPF-PENSION DEDUCTIONS

Amends the Chicago Teacher Article of the Illinois Pension Code. Provides that an Employer or the Board of Trustees shall make pension deductions in each pay period on the basis of the salary earned in that period, exclusive of salaries for overtime, extracurricular activities (instead of special services), or any employment on an optional basis, such as summer school. Makes conforming changes. Effective immediately.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2019-02-14 Filed with the Clerk by Rep. Robert Martwick filing
  • 2019-02-14 First Reading reading-1
  • 2019-02-14 Referred to Rules Committee referral-committee
  • 2019-02-26 Assigned to Personnel & Pensions Committee referral-committee
  • 2019-03-07 Do Pass / Short Debate Personnel & Pensions Committee; 010-000-000 committee-passage
  • 2019-03-07 Placed on Calendar 2nd Reading - Short Debate
  • 2019-03-19 Second Reading - Short Debate reading-2
  • 2019-03-19 Placed on Calendar Order of 3rd Reading - Short Debate
  • 2019-03-29 Third Reading - Short Debate - Passed 098-001-000 reading-3, passage
  • 2019-04-03 Arrive in Senate introduction
  • 2019-04-03 Placed on Calendar Order of First Reading reading-1
  • 2019-04-03 Chief Senate Sponsor Sen. Omar Aquino
  • 2019-04-03 First Reading reading-1
  • 2019-04-03 Referred to Assignments referral-committee
  • 2019-04-24 Assigned to Government Accountability and Ethics referral-committee
  • 2019-05-01 Do Pass Government Accountability and Ethics; 009-000-000 committee-passage
  • 2019-05-01 Placed on Calendar Order of 2nd Reading May 2, 2019
  • 2019-05-16 Second Reading reading-2
  • 2019-05-16 Placed on Calendar Order of 3rd Reading May 17, 2019
  • 2019-05-21 Third Reading - Passed; 056-000-000 reading-3, passage
  • 2019-05-21 Passed Both Houses
  • 2019-06-19 Sent to the Governor executive-receipt
  • 2019-08-09 Governor Approved executive-signature
  • 2019-08-09 Effective Date August 9, 2019
  • 2019-08-09 Public Act . . . . . . . . . 101-0261 became-law
